Description
As part of its Youth Programme, and in the wider context of the European Green Deal, the Joint Research Centre (JRC) hosts a monthly series of Digital School Seminars for secondary schools in English and Italian.
They are titled “Science is everywhere” and touching upon environmental and other issues, such as food, health, biodiversity, energy and cybersecurity & big data.
The next of these seminars in Italian, titled “Let’s talk about…Cybersecurity and Big data”, focuses on the technical solutions our scientists are researching to counteract cyber attacks, natural disasters and technical failures that disrupt digital systems, causing major economic and social damage.
The broad spectrum of knowledge is distilled and introduced by the scientists themselves through a presentation and debate among colleagues.
